Introduction
Bad Dogg from Mr H Genetics extends the Dawg genetic family tradition with an extra letter twist — the "Dogg" spelling evoking both the Snoop Dogg connection to West Coast cannabis culture and the broader Dawg lineage that traces back to Chemdawg. Mr H Genetics operates as an independent breeding program developing genetics that carry the Dawg family's characteristic potency and aromatic complexity into contemporary hybrid crosses. As an indica/sativa hybrid flowering in approximately 70 days, Bad Dogg takes its time developing the complex character that genuine Dawg genetics require.
Lineage
Mr H Genetics works with premium American genetics in the tradition of independent craft breeders who prioritize exceptional phenotypes over rapid commercial releases. The 70-day flowering window indicates meaningful sativa influence in the genetics — Dawg-derived hybrids often carry some of the sativa expression from Chemdawg's complex heritage, which includes genetic influence from Colombian, Thai, and other sativa sources that run through the OG Kush and Chemdawg lineages.

Growth
The 70-day development window allows the Dawg genetics to fully express their characteristic terpene profile: the diesel fuel and lemon that define Chemdawg descendants, the earthy hash-plant notes of the OG influence, and the subtle complexity that multiple generations of careful selection have added to these essential characters.
Effects
Effects are potent and complex — the Dawg family's signature cerebral engagement alongside deep physical relaxation, the kind of multifaceted experience that makes Chemdawg-derived genetics so persistently popular.
